Fran Garcia may have been one of Real Madrid’s standout players in the recently concluded FIFA Club World Cup,as he managed to impress the new coach in his early days under his command.

The club’s decision to sign Alvaro Carreras, however, provides him with more than enough reason to see his future as insecure, especially given that the former Benfica defender arrives eyeing a starting spot.


OneFootball Video


With Ferland Mendy also in contention for a starting place, it is clear that either Mendy or Garcia must leave and the latter appears to be edging towards an exit to prioritise his playing time.

Following Modric’s footsteps?

As relayed in a recent report by AS, Garcia’s agent Gines Carvajal has started talks with AC Milan over a potential transfer for his client. His contacts began soon after Real Madrid completed the Carreras deal.

With Garcia’s situation at the club now complicated, talks with the Serie A giants are underway to discuss a potential move and Luka Modric, who recently left Real Madrid for AC Milan, is supporting the notion in Italy.

The relationship between Los Blancos and the Rossoneri is excellent, and with AC Milan looking desperately for a new full-back, a deal may well work out.

Notably, however, it was not the club that came looking for Garcia but the player’s agent who initiated the contacts.

The talks between the two parties are currently informal and still far from being concrete. Modric is internally pushing for his former teammate to join under Massimiliano Allegri.

In the Club World Cup, the Real Madrid left-back made six starts for the club, scoring one goal and providing one assist in the process. Further, he averaged 0.8 key passes and over 11 defensive actions per game.
